This Misc. Civil Application is taken out by the petitioner by showing sufficient cause not to appear on the date when the matter was dismissed for want of prosecution.
2. Considering the averments made in the application, we are convinced that there was no intentional reason to avoid the proceedings and as sufficient cause is shown, the application is allowed in terms of prayer clause (a). No costs. The writ petition be listed for admission in regular course. NUTAN D. SARDESSAI, J.
